Description
One Line Summary
Use current asynchronous subscription getters, retain callback references for removal, fix the removeAliases syntax, and replace removed in-app-message handler APIs with addEventListener examples.
Compatibility and observable changes
Documentation only; no runtime behavior changes. The guide remains a v4-to-v5 migration reference rather than a promise of full latest-version API coverage.
Details
Motivation
The source audit reproduced the failure paths described below. This PR contains only the associated fix; unrelated audit changes are in separate PRs.
Scope
MIGRATION_GUIDE.mdTesting
Six extracted migration snippets type-check against current SDK declarations; the baseline has five missing-reference, syntax, or obsolete-method errors.
Each code/tooling fix was also applied independently to upstream commit
a70312207cf094ac361eaa9196c317acb175c2cdand passed its targeted external actual-source diagnostics. Documentation snippets were checked separately. Native diagnostic harnesses use bridge/SDK doubles and are not an end-to-end push test.On the combined audit branch:
vp check: formatting, lint and type checks pass; native Spotless check passes.No checked-in test files were added or modified; regression evidence comes from external diagnostic harnesses and the existing suite. No physical-device, live notification delivery, Appium/BrowserStack, or release-workflow execution is claimed. The no-location example's stale native lock was updated locally to resolve the current SDK for verification; generated locks are not part of this PR.
